How to Use Related Technologies

A smart agriculture system uses IoT sensors to monitor soil moisture, temperature, and humidity. The data is sent to a cloud server where AI algorithms analyze it and provide recommendations for irrigation and fertilization. You can use Arduino or Raspberry Pi for IoT devices, TensorFlow for AI, and Firebase for cloud storage. Farmers can access the data via a mobile app and receive real-time alerts.
